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6090703 125725050 8423345 6899899193
788935465 36 83
788935465 36 83
79438 2255274 0363 5943015050
All about undefined
Interested in learning more?
788935465 36 83
79438 2255274 0363 5943015050
See more
06 1403
0118110 442 579 9629
See more
32316898 04553
19824 2439 08179 79
See more